Compromised pipe joints
Pipeline joints are the parts of our plumbing system where the pipelines attach. They are the weakest point of our plumbing system. Therefore, they are extra prone to degeneration. It is necessary to keep in mind that even though pipelines are designed to stand up to pressure as well as last for some time, they weren't designed to last permanently; consequently, they would weaken gradually. This deterioration could result in fractures in plumbing systems. A typical indication of damaged pipe joints is excessive sound from taps.
High water pressure
You discovered your residence water stress is higher than normal yet then, why should you care? It's out of your control.
It would certainly be best if you cared because your typical water stress must be 60 Psi (per square inch) and although your house's plumbing system is developed to endure 80 Psi. A boost in water stress can place a strain on your house pipelines and lead to cracks, or worse, burst pipes. Obtain in touch with an expert about managing it if you ever notice that your residence water pressure is higher than usual.

Blocked drains
Food bits, dirt, and also oil can trigger blocked drains and obstruct the passage of water in and out of your sink. If undealt with, enhanced pressure within the gutters can finish and also trigger an overflow up splitting or breaking pipelines. To avoid blocked drains in your house, we advise you to prevent putting particles down the drain as well as normal cleansing of sinks.
Broken seals
One more source of water leaks in homes is broken seals of house devices that make use of water, e.g., a dishwasher. When such appliances are installed, seals are set up around water ports for easy passage of water through the device. Thus, a broken seal can cause leak of water when in operation.

Health Hazards
In most circumstances, it’s not so much the leak itself that can be hazardous to you and your family’s health, but the mould, mildew and material damage that leaks cause. These problems can develop unseen in the structure and foundations of your home and might only be discovered after they’ve caused harmful illnesses or costly damages.
Mould is a particular concern, producing toxic chemicals called mycotoxins that can cause allergic reactions, hypersensitivity and respiratory problems. Additionally, stagnant water can cause accidents or allow undesirable insects and bacteria to breed around your home or office. These potential problems can all be avoided by getting an experienced professional to take a look at your leaking taps or pipes when you first notice them.
Saving Water
A leaky tap or pipe can waste anything up to 20,000 litres of water per year! We live in Adelaide, which is the driest state on the driest inhabited continent on earth. A small leak can have a significant impact on our environment when left to its own devices.
As climate change, droughts and a growing population start to impact the environment around us, everyone in Adelaide should do their part to help conserve our precious water resources. While saving water in any way around your house is always a positive, helping to save water can be as simple as contacting a licensed Adelaide plumber to get your leaky tap fixed for good!
Saving Money
With the changes in climate, decreasing rainfall averages and a greater demand for water resources, charges for water utilities have risen dramatically in Adelaide. South Australians are consistently paying more than the rest of the country for our water use, and rates are continuing to rise.
Considering how much water a leaking tap can waste over the course of a year, this is a cost many families can’t afford to ignore. Even at the lowest volume charge by SA Water, this can add $100s to your water bill each year. And that doesn’t even take into consideration the other expenses that a leaking tap can create. Left long enough, a leak can damage the tap so severely that it requires replacing the entire tap system, increasing the repair cost.
